    @FlyingNinjaish Před 2 lety +100

    Five kilotons isn't actually very large, as nuclear weapons go. Even airbursted, it wouldn't cover all of most modern medium-size cities.

    • @FlyingNinjaish
      @FlyingNinjaish Před 2 lety +15

      @@kalxek1462 not even- an airburst expands the blast overpressure zone, but that won't do anything so far as sterilizing the pathogen goes - that would be driven more by the thermal raidation emitted, which would suffer fron less occlusion by ground objects in an airbust, but is (relatively) minuscule in a 5 kt detonation. If they meant 5MT, it would be a more plausible solution, but really not possible to disguise as anything else. But that's also 3 orders of magnitude off from what they actually said.

    @epigeios Před 2 lety +18

    Just so you know, if someone is far-sighted, they need glasses to read and use computers, but they don't need glasses to see normal things at a normal distance. If a far-sighted person wears glasses for computer use, they would need to take off their glasses to look at distant things.
    Sometimes, far-sighted people want small glasses so that they don't need to take them off too much.
    That way, if they see something in their peripheral vision, they don't need to turn their head to look at it, and they don't need to take off their glasses to look at it.
